Veteran utility player Culberson, who played for only the third time in the past 32 games, hit his second homer in the third. Texas got even on Heim’s 16th homer in the bottom half, then went ahead in the fifth when Bubba Thompson had an RBI double and scored on Marcus Semien’s single. Trevino’s solo homer in the fourth inning, his 11th overall but first in 40 games, put the Yankees up 2-1. New York starter Domingo Germán (2-5) gave up four runs over 4 1/3 innings, ending his career-best streak of 12 consecutive starts allowing three earned runs or fewer. Matt Moore, the third Texas reliever, worked the ninth for his fifth save in six chances. Rangers rookie Glenn Otto (7-10) struck out five and walked two while allowing two runs and four hits over six innings.
